Transparency Program Question

How does the transparency program keep other sellers from selling your counterfeit products via FBM? If Amazon never sees the products that are shipped straight from the FBM seller to the customer, how will Amazon ever know whether there is a transparency code attached to the item?

It doesn't, it is the seller's responsibility to do it, if you are the rightful owner of the product.

You take your USTPO registration documentation and other legal documents for the product (patients, COC's, etc.) showing you are the actual product owner and send them to Amazon's Legal office in Seattle by certified mail. They will straighten things our is a week or so.

If you don't have the legal documentation, usually you are out of luck and nothing will change.

The orders come in with a transparency badge to let you know it is a transparency order. Before any FBM 3P seller can confirm shipment, they must provide the unique-matching transparency code.

seller generates a code for a unit of an ASIN and applies the related label to box before shipping. This code has to be provided on the manage orders page in order to list/fufill these offers.

One would have to put in the code on that specific order that matches that specific Brand+ASIN+unit before confirming the order. If no code, or an invalid code is entered, you cant confirm shipment and your offers will be removed from the ASIN.
